New Metro Transit Center Opens in Falls Church

The improved bus depot has better lighting and improved signage.

A new transit center opened in Falls Church, Va., Friday.

“You are here maps” and bus shelters that display route times are featured at the new bus depot at Leesburg Pike and Route 50, adjacent to the Seven Corners Shopping Center. They also offer new and improved lighting. 

The revamped area was designed to help relieve traffic around the parking areas of the mall.

“This new facility provides improved amenities for bus riders while improving traffic flow,” Metro General Manager Richard Sarles said.

Metro bus routes 1A, 1B, 1E, 1F, 4A, 4B, 4H, 28A and 28X operate out of the new transit center.  About 1,000 passengers will use the new transit center each weekday.
